Transaction 87f80382dd9e0c201155407da259524d132b0daf7da3447063fb25159393be9f
2 Input
1 Outputs
- 87f80382dd9e0c201155407da259524d132b0daf7da3447063fb25159393be9f:0
value 872874
address 3J3SdxGNGb9fZrcmaSRQLBWKLtqPZ5BLoM